Dream Kiss
Dream kiss Just like in the ocean so vast and wide and deep. Are the hearts of lovers dreaming while they sleep. Alone I stand upon this shore staring out to sea. Believing somewhere out there, someone’s looking back at me. I raise my hand to shield my eyes from the bright light of the sun. Then look out to the horizon. To see if I can see the one. The one that will chase my loneliness forever far away. At last I see there’s no one there, I have to wait another day. I walk out to the water and get down on bended knee. I place a kiss inside my hand, then put it in the sea. I imagine that I can watch it as waves toss it to and fro. Knowing as I watch and wait our love can only grow. I watch until the sun sinks down giving way to night. Taking with it in all its glory the last rays of daylight. In the dark alone I sit heart aching wanting more. As I listen to the ocean kiss the rocks along the shore. Edwin C Hofert
